Mariakerke surf guide

Mariakerke is a small beach town that’s known for a surf spot called ‘Ollie’s Point’. This area has a laid-back vibe and gets its fair share of surfers looking for some fun waves. It's not the most crowded spot around, but it can still get busy, especially when conditions are right. The beach features standard beach breaks that usually come alive after a big north storm when the wind calms down.

The waves here can handle swell sizes starting from around 1ft (0.3 meters) and work best with a North swell direction, but you might also catch some good ones if the swell comes from the Northwest or Northeast. The breaks over sand, and you can ride both lefts and rights, which is great for surfers at various skill levels. It’s a good spot for beginners since it’s pretty forgiving, especially at mid to high tides with a preferred southeast wind. Just keep an eye on the rips; they can be a little tricky at times.

While Ollie’s Point is a highlight, there are plenty of other similar waves up and down the beach that might suit your preference better on certain days. Don't hesitate to explore; you might find a hidden gem nearby that’s less crowded and just as fun.
